Nintendo has released the latest Nintendo Switch 2 eShop charts for the week ending July 12, 2026, with Moonlight Peaks – Nintendo Switch 2 Edition emerging as the platform’s best-selling title.
The cozy vampire farming simulator climbed to the top of the rankings, surpassing major first-party releases and highlighting its growing popularity among Switch 2 players.
The updated charts also welcomed several new entries, led by Digimon Story: Time Stranger and Granblue Fantasy: Relink – Endless Ragnarok, both of which secured multiple spots across the overall and download-only rankings.
Moonlight Peaks Overtakes Star Fox in Weekly Rankings
After spending previous weeks behind Nintendo’s biggest exclusives, Moonlight Peaks – Nintendo Switch 2 Edition has climbed to the No. 1 position in the All Games chart. It edged out Star Fox, which settled for second place, while Mario Kart World remained among the platform’s strongest sellers in fifth.
Other familiar names continued to perform well, including Pokémon Pokopia, Final Fantasy VII Rebirth, The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ild – Nintendo Switch 2 Edition, and Cyberpunk 2077, demonstrating the diverse mix of first-party exclusives and third-party releases attracting Switch 2 owners.

One of the week’s biggest stories is the strong launch of Digimon Story: Time Stranger. The RPG entered the overall chart with three editions, including the Ultimate Edition at No. 3, the standard edition at No. 4, and the Deluxe Edition at No. 13.
Meanwhile, Granblue Fantasy: Relink – Endless Ragnarok also enjoyed a successful debut, securing two positions in the overall top ten while climbing to No. 2 in the download-only rankings. Other digital standouts included Deltarune, Hades 2 – Nintendo Switch 2 Edition, Devil May Cry 5, and Red Dead Redemption – Nintendo Switch 2 Edition.
